Aminah Nichols, Coordinator of the College Reach Out Program, was WKTK98.5's Woman of the Week for her extraordinary work not only at Santa Fe but in the other projects that enrich our community. Below is an excerpt from her nomination for Woman of the Week:
Aminah is the most incredible young woman who is the Coordinator of the CROP - College Reach Out Program. But she is much more than just that. She provides spring and summer activities coordinated with UF and Santa Fe to provide educational experiences for middles school students who may be at risk. She provides warmth, counseling, direction and support. Aminah is a role model for them and for the tutors who work for her. Her family is extremely important to her and she drives to South Florida for all family events. Aminah is strong, intelligent, giving, going far beyond what is required of her. There is so much more to this amazing young woman but I wanted to ask you to celebrate her and the brightness she brings to others. Thank you.

William Penn of Pennsylvania

Today we toured Philly on the Philadelphia Sightseeing Tour Bus! It was a little ambitious of us to choose to ride the top level of the double decker in 40 degree weather but it was well worth it. 
We learned of the cities history and the Quaker foundation on which William Penn's built the city. He had 3 focuses which still hold true today- Freedom of Expressions, Freedom of Religion and 
Freedom of something else I can't remember. lol! (sorry) 


Moving on... they showed us the initial city limits, first churches, homes and market places that are still standing and in use since before the war. We also saw the building that was Franklin's home, printing press and first city post office while  he was in Philly back in the 1700's. We didn't get a chance to visit the Franklin Institute, Constitution Center, Liberty Bell or Please Touch museum, but we did see them and learned about the cool facts and exhibits they each behold. When I return, visiting each of those will be first on my list!!! We did however climb the Rockie Stairs :)))) That was fun! And when you reach the top, the view of the city if breathtaking. It's not a complete skyline view, but it's a panoramic view of many scopes of the city! 

We ended our night with Tootoo's pizza and wings and lounging at the Landmark- a lounge in downtown Philly off Market and 34th in the Drexel University Area. We enjoyed laughs, drinks and great conversation with our friends!
